Melissa,

I ran some tests using different versions of NCL on dim_pqsort, and
for at least three versions back, I got the same results: you cannot
reorder an arry directly in a call to dim_pqsort and have the
reordered array saved upon exit. *This is not a bug*.

As Dennis pointed out in an earlier posting , this is because a
temporary variable has to be created when you do the reorder, and
"dim_pqsort" doesn't know anything about the original array to
reorder it upon return.

The example on the dim_pqsort page that you reference is passing in
opt=1, which specifies to *not* reorder the original array. You are
using opt=2 which is to reorder the original array.

I've added a caveat to this page that explains if you want the
original array reordered, then you either need to use a temporary
variable and reassign it upon exit, or, better yet, use dim_pqsort_n.

>> Dennis Shea wrote:
>>> Consider
>>>
>>> pv22 = dim_pqsort(b2(nlsd|:,time|:),2)
>>>
>>> I *think* that NCL creates a temporary variable [say, "q"].
>>> This temporary variable which contains reordered "b2"
>>> is sorted correctly. However, the temporary variable
>>> "q" is not being placed back into the *original* variable
>>> "b2" address space.
>>>
>>> I have not tested but I speculate that using dim_pqsort_n
>>> will fix the problem
>>>
>>> pv22 = dim_pqsort_n(b2, 2, 0)
